Advantage (ADV) earnings analysis | quarterly performance and technical momentum remain in focus. Advantage Solutions Inc. (ADV)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$0.81, dramatically surpassing the consensus estimate of $0.1111 and recording a surprise of 629.07%. Revenue figures were not disclosed, and the stock declined by 4.27% following the announcement. The sharp EPS beat suggests strong operational efficiency or favorable one-time items, but the lack of revenue detail may have tempered investor enthusiasm.
